Gunna and Offset flirt with a joint album—just don’t hold your breath yet
Fresh off his album The Last Wun, Gunna confirms that a joint project with Offset is on simmer. Speaking during his Apple Music Live chat with Ebro Darden, Gunna admits the collaboration is “in the works,” though both artists are deliberately spacing their releases.
After dropping individual albums—trading bars on Offset’s “Different Species” and Gunna’s “At My Purest”—they hint that the breadcrumb trail of guest spots will culminate in a full-course duet.

Gunna tiptoes through turmoil with 25-track “The Last Wun” and no goodbyes
Gunna resurfaces with The Last Wun, a 25-track expanse shaped by Turbo’s production and punctuated with appearances from Wizkid, Offset, and Burna Boy. This release trails One of Wun and arrives draped in speculation—possibly the swan song of his YSL chapter, complicated by the silent fallout from his RICO plea deal.
The cover art—a meditative painting by DeJardin—mirrors this ambiguous climate, hinting at emotional turbulence through symbols of veiled unrest and composed persistence. Gunna, still perched on the Billboard 200 radar, stands poised—but not declaring—for what comes next.
